Los Angeles: Gaviota Peak
Scale rugged coastal hills to a solitary peak in the Santa Ynez Mountains on this 6.7-mile loop. Bonus: Soak in the natural hot springs.

Gaviota Peak (2,458 ft.): On clear days, see from Channel Islands to Point Conception, where the CA coastline turns sharply N. Golden eagles coast seaborne thermals
